About the company

Morgan Advanced Materials plc manufactures and sells various carbon and ceramic products. The company operates through Thermal Products, Performance Carbon, and Technical Ceramics segments. The Thermal Products segment manufactures products, systems, and solutions, such as crucibles, foundry products, furnace industries furnace range products, insulating fibre and microporous products, firebricks and mortars, and heat shields used in industrial metal processing, petrochemicals, cement, ceramics, and glass, as well as by manufacturers of equipment for aerospace, automotive, marine, and domestic applications. The Performance Carbon segment develops and manufactures carbon, graphite, and carbide products, including semiconductor consumables, collector strips and carbon brushes, graphite powders, face seals, sliding bearings, shafts, and rotary vane pump components for charging and driving EVs, wind turbines, and power generation, as well as for the security and defense sector. How we calculate Fair Value

Each company is valued through a stack of independent intrinsic-value models (DCF variants, residual-income, multiples and more), blended into one family-balanced consensus and weighted by how much trustworthy data backs it. A separate quality layer scores the fundamentals. Every input is real reported data — nothing guessed.
